Brookfield's Risk Management Framework

Brookfield's success is not accidental; it's built upon a robust and sophisticated risk management framework. This framework allows them to not only survive market downturns but to thrive in them. Key components include diversification, a long-term investment horizon, and meticulous due diligence.

Diversification Across Asset Classes

Brookfield's vast portfolio is a cornerstone of its risk mitigation strategy. Instead of concentrating investments in a single sector, they strategically allocate capital across a diverse range of asset classes. This includes:

  • Real Estate: A significant portion of their portfolio encompasses diverse real estate holdings, from residential and commercial properties to logistics and data centers. This diversification reduces reliance on any single property market.
  • Infrastructure: Brookfield invests heavily in essential infrastructure projects globally, such as transportation networks, utilities, and energy transmission. These assets often demonstrate resilience during economic downturns.
  • Renewable Power: With a growing focus on sustainability, Brookfield invests in renewable energy assets like wind and solar farms, providing stable cash flows and long-term growth potential.
  • Private Equity: Investing in privately held companies allows Brookfield to access opportunities not available in public markets and benefit from active portfolio management.

This diversification ensures a balanced exposure across various economic cycles. If one sector experiences a downturn, others may offset the losses, providing stability to their overall portfolio. Furthermore, their strategic allocation of capital across diverse geographies further minimizes risk associated with regional economic fluctuations.

Long-Term Investment Horizon

Brookfield's patient capital approach is a key differentiator. They focus on the long-term fundamental value of their assets, rather than being swayed by short-term market fluctuations. This long-term perspective allows them:

  • To weather short-term market downturns: They are not forced to sell assets at distressed prices during periods of market stress.
  • To benefit from long-term value appreciation: Their patience allows them to capture the full potential of their investments over time.
  • To make strategic adjustments: This long-term approach allows them the time to adjust their strategy as needed based on changing market conditions.

Deep Due Diligence and Thorough Analysis

Before making any investment, Brookfield undertakes rigorous due diligence and analysis. Their experienced teams, each with specialized expertise in their respective asset classes, conduct in-depth research, leveraging:

  • Experienced teams with specialized expertise: This ensures a thorough understanding of the specific risks and opportunities within each investment.
  • In-depth market research and financial modeling: This allows for accurate valuation and risk assessment.
  • Comprehensive risk assessment and mitigation strategies: This proactive approach minimizes potential downsides and maximizes the chances of success.

Identifying and Capitalizing on Opportunistic Investments

Brookfield's strategic response to market volatility involves not just risk mitigation, but actively seeking out opportunities. Their ability to identify and capitalize on undervalued assets is a core competency.

Strategic Acquisitions During Market Downturns

During periods of market stress, Brookfield actively seeks out undervalued assets, leveraging their strong balance sheet and financial resources to:

  • Acquire distressed assets at significant discounts: This allows them to acquire high-quality assets at prices well below their intrinsic value.
  • Consolidate market share during periods of weakness: They use downturns to strategically expand their holdings in attractive sectors.
  • Repurpose or reposition acquired assets for enhanced returns: They often add value through renovations, operational improvements, or strategic repositioning.

Value Creation Through Operational Expertise

Brookfield's operational expertise is a significant source of competitive advantage. They don't just buy assets; they actively manage and enhance them. This includes:

  • Improving operational efficiency and reducing costs: They streamline operations, implement cost-saving measures, and improve productivity.
  • Implementing innovative strategies to increase revenue: They actively seek ways to increase the profitability of their holdings.
  • Active portfolio management and value enhancement initiatives: This continuous focus on improvement delivers superior returns.

Strategic Partnerships and Joint Ventures

Brookfield strategically collaborates with other experienced investors, leveraging shared expertise and reducing individual risk exposure. These partnerships offer:

  • Access to broader networks and deal flow: This increases their ability to find attractive investment opportunities.
  • Sharing of expertise and resources: This enhances their ability to manage complex transactions and assets.
  • Reduced capital commitment per individual investment: This spreads risk and allows for a diversified portfolio of investments.
